How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Mazyck Wraggborough?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Mazyck Wraggborough Studio Apartments | $2,377 | $1,085 | $4,536 |
| Mazyck Wraggborough 1 Bedroom Apartments | $3,100 | $1,155 | $9,385 |
| Mazyck Wraggborough 2 Bedroom Apartments | $4,340 | $1,377 | $10,000+ |
| Mazyck Wraggborough 3 Bedroom Apartments | $8,386 | $1,259 | $10,000+ |
| Mazyck Wraggborough 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,907 | $1,199 | $8,000 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Mazyck Wraggborough
How much are Studio apartments in Mazyck Wraggborough?
There are currently 126 Studio Apartments in Mazyck Wraggborough with rent ranges from $1,085 to $4,536 with an average price of $2,377.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Mazyck Wraggborough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Mazyck Wraggborough ranges from $1,155 to $9,385 with an average monthly rent of $3,100.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Mazyck Wraggborough c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Mazyck Wraggborough range from $1,377 to $15,000.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$4,340.
How expensive are Mazyck Wraggborough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 59 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Mazyck Wraggborough on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,259 to $23,000 - averaging $8,386 for the location.
